Facilities Ticket — Cleaning Crew Access, Brindle Annex

For new starters handling evening lock-up: the Sorano Cleaning crew arrives nightly at 21:30 via the annex side door. Check their rota sheet, note arrival in the log, and ensure the storeroom is relocked afterward. To let them through the side door, enter the access code below.

badge for yaweg-hafog: bdg-GX-6

## Postmortem Timeline — Resetfall Incident, Entry 4

14:05 — The revamped password reset flow on Quillport shipped to all regions. 14:22 — Support began receiving reports that reset links expired immediately. 14:31 — Engineering confirmed the new token TTL was set in seconds, not minutes. 14:40 — Hotfix prepared; reset emails paused to prevent further failed attempts. 15:02 — Hotfix deployed, queue drained, success rates recovered. Support may tell affected users to request a fresh link. The trace token for the failing build appears below.

pipeline stamp: htk9_ce63042d9

## Dark Mode — Admin Dashboard (Quillgate)

Dark-mode theming in the Quillgate admin dashboard is owned by the Interface Platform team. CSS variable overrides live in `theme/dusk.css`; no user data is touched. Security questions about contrast tokens or theme injection go to Marta Evel, team lead. Reach her at the address below.

alerts address for kajog-tadup: druox@plorvanet.internal